A week ago, I took the '53 and sickle mower out to the flying field to knock down the tall grass around the runway.
Got 1-1/2 times around the first small section when it started making an awful clatter up in the bell housing. It makes a continuous clatter while running, and won't move on its own.
I had to drag it back to the parking lot on the end of a chain and push it up onto the trailer...
I had the tractor all apart over the winter to do the rear main seal, and everything looked fine. Not sure what's wrong but I'll take any bets on what it might be.
